Workshops Agenda
• Oct. 6: Overview of Born-digital Workflow, Pre-accessioning (Digital
  Material Survey), Accessioning (Media count, rehouse, label, media
  photograph)

• Oct. 20: Accessioning (disk imaging using FTK Imager, create FTK
  case, collection summary, AT accession record), Processing using
  FTK(technical appraisal, search terms/patterns for sensitive
  materials)

• Oct 27: Processing (labeling, bookmarking, report, processing notes
  for finding aid)

• Nov 3: Delivery (Hypatia); Processing Images; Processing Emails

• Part I: This part of the survey is designed to be a
  prompt sheet for phone / face-to-face interview
  with donors by curators / digital archivists.

• Part II: This part of the survey is designed to be
  filled out by digital archivists regarding technical
  details of the tools used to create digital material.

Feasibility Study
• Equipment (punch card reader, tape reader,
  etc.)
• Passwords
• Outsource
  – Recovery for 1 hard drive $2,500
  – Reformat tape to CD/DVD: $150 per tape plus the
    output media and shipping. $25 for a DVD.
AT Accession Record
•   Media count
•   Computer count
•   Size in MB/TB, etc.
•   No. of files
•   Link to
    – Image log spreadsheet
    – Collection summary from FTK
Media Count
• Media count by
  – 3, 3.5, 5.25, 8 inch. floppy diskettes
  – Zip disk
  – Open reel, cartridge tape
  – CD, DVD, Optical disk
  – External hard drive
• Computer
  – Desktop / Portable
  – Mac / PC / Others

Media Label /Rehouse
• Label
  – Use “Call No._CMxxx” as label name, 0.5 x 1.875 inch.
    label
  – Template http://www.avery.com/avery/en_us/Templates-
    %26-Software/Templates/Labels/Return-Address-
    Labels/Return-Address-Label-80-per-sheet_Microsoft-
    Word.htm?N=0&refchannel=c042fd03ab30a110VgnVCM1
    000002118140aRCRD

• Re-House
  – Follow the same box no. naming convention as other
    materials (paper, av, etc.).

Filename
• Photographing media
  – Use ““Call No._CMxxx “ as filename
  – If more than 1 photo is taken, add _1 for first and
    _2 for second photo, etc. (e.g. front, back, box,
    etc.)
  – Use computer to control the camera if you have
    more than 20 media to photo; otherwise, just use
    stand alone camera.
  – Store all photos in “Media Photo” folder
